The Perrot Company is a computer manufacturer and had the fallowing transactions and events during the year. Estimated overhead for the year was $175,00; estimated labor for the year was 6,000 hours.

a. Purchase materials on account, $126,000.

b. Traced materials to jobs $110,880; general shop materials used $9,500.

c.labor traced to jobs $165,000, untraced labor was $22,200.

d.Overhead incurred (not including materials or labor): $139,600.

e.Overhead is applied to jobs based on labor hours. All workers were paid $30/hr.

f. Ending work-in-process consisted of one job with a cost of $1,976. There was no beginning work-in-process.

g. Completed jobs were billed to the customers for $476,000.

REQUIRED:

1. Prepare the journal entries to record the transactions for the year.

2.Prepare the journal entry to write-off the over- or underapplied overhead to the cost of the jobs. assume the over or underapplied overhead is immaterial.
